Copper gutters are a type of gutter system made from high-quality copper, designed to channel rainwater away from the roof and foundation of a building. Unlike traditional gutter materials such as aluminum or vinyl, copper gutters offer a unique combination of durability, aesthetics, and longevity.
Copper gutters are incredibly durable and can last for decades, often outliving the buildings they are installed on. The natural properties of copper make it resistant to corrosion and weathering, ensuring that your gutters will remain functional and intact through harsh weather conditions.
One of the most notable benefits of copper gutters is their aesthetic appeal. Copper starts with a bright, shiny appearance that gradually develops a beautiful greenish patina over time. This patina is highly sought after for its classic, timeless look, adding a touch of elegance and character to any building.
Copper gutters require very little maintenance compared to other materials. The patina that forms on copper acts as a protective layer, preventing rust and corrosion. This means you won't need to worry about frequent repairs or replacements, making copper gutters a hassle-free option in the long run.
While the initial cost of copper gutters can be higher than other materials, their longevity and low maintenance requirements make them a cost-effective choice over time. Investing in copper gutters can also add value to your property, as they are considered a premium feature by many homebuyers.
Copper is a natural material that is fully recyclable. Using copper gutters reduces the need for synthetic materials, which can have a more significant environmental impact. Additionally, the long lifespan of copper gutters means fewer resources are used over time for replacements and repairs.
Copper has natural anti-fungal and anti-microbial properties, which means that mold and mildew are less likely to grow in or on copper gutters. This keeps your gutter system cleaner and more efficient, preventing blockages and other issues related to mold growth.
Copper gutters can withstand extreme weather conditions, including heavy rainfall, snow, and ice. Their sturdy construction and resistance to thermal expansion and contraction make them an ideal choice for areas with variable climates.

The aluminum coil is a metal product that is subjected to flying shear after being rolled by a casting and rolling machine and processed by drawing and bending angles. Aluminum coils can be widely used in electronics, packaging, construction, machinery, transportation, heat transfer, insulation materials, etc. The following will introduce 9 different aluminum coils and their uses.
After the aluminum coil is cleaned, chromized, roller coated, baked, etc., the surface of the aluminum coil is coated with various colors of paint, that is, a color-coated aluminum coil.
Colored aluminum is widely used in aluminum-plastic panels, honeycomb panels, insulation panels, aluminum curtain walls, shutters, roller shutters, aluminum-magnesium-manganese roofing systems, aluminum Ceilings, household appliances, down pipes, aluminum cans, and many other fields.
Coated aluminum coils can be simply divided into polyester (PE) coated aluminum coils and fluorocarbon (PVDF) coated aluminum coils due to different types of surface paint. Of course, there are also situations where one side is coated with fluorocarbon and the other side is coated with polyester; there are even cases where both sides are coated with fluorocarbon.
Aluminum coils are embossed, also known as embossed aluminum coils, with various patterns such as orange peel and diamond.
Because of different uses, it is also commonly called roofing material (aluminum-magnesium-manganese roofing system), ceiling material (for aluminum alloy ceiling), home appliance board (used for interior and exterior decoration of household appliances), food material (food-grade chromium and roller coating), brushed board (the surface has been brushed), etc.

Aluminum-plastic composite panel, referred to as aluminum-plastic panel, is a new type of material made of a surface-treated aluminum plate with a coating and baking paint as the surface, a polyethylene plastic plate as the core layer, and processed through a series of processes.
The aluminum corrugated composite panel is a kind of all-aluminum composite panel formed by vacuum compounding aluminum alloy panel, base plate, and aluminum corrugated core.
The inner and outer layers of aluminum alloy honeycomb panels are aluminum alloy sheets, and the middle interlayer is a regular hexagonal aluminum foil honeycomb core. The honeycomb core is bonded and compounded with structural adhesive and an aluminum alloy surface plate.

For the manufacture of aluminum alloy gutters and aluminum alloy downspouts, H24 and H24 aluminum alloys are used, both sides of the aluminum coil are coated with polyester paint, the thickness of the front film is 25-28 um, and the film thickness of the back is 15-18 um. The color is durable.
Due to their good mechanical properties, aluminum coils are easy to bend, weld, and rail-pressed during processing, making them ideal raw materials for manufacturers of aluminum alloy gutters and downspouts at home and abroad.
